JOB SUMMARY

The Driver facilitates clients' transportation to and from necessary appointments at one of Promises Behavioral Health Residential Program Facilities.

 J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Transports clients per supervisor's directives (for court, ancillary services, etc.)
  • Follows emergency procedures exactly to secure safety and welfare of clients.
  • Notifies appropriate Clinical staff member or Executive Director of any client behavior that could create a risk to the clients’ wellbeing or treatment success.
  • Completes and submits are necessary forms and documentation.
  • Serves as back-up for residential assistances as needed.
  • Assists with set-up and take-down for all special events and functions.
  • Pick up mail daily.
  • Provides tours for aftercare on weekend.
  • Transports clients to special meetings when needed.
  • Schedule includes being available during on-call schedule.

JOB QUALIFICAITONS

  • High school diploma or GED.
  • Valid Driver's License.
  • Class F endorsement (or willing to obtain).
  • Clear driving record.
  • Current automobile insurance.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Excels working within a team.
  • Ability to follow directions.
  • CPR/First Aid Certification is required for this position. If not CPR/First Aid certified at time of hire, certification must be obtained within the state mandated time frame after first day of employment.
